Apiar Eggs
This student project reimagines egg cartons with a hexagonal shape, inspired by beehives. The unique design makes transport and storage easier while holding six eggs securely. It even has two clever openings, front and back, sealed with a tape strip. [source ]

Domilovo
Made of eco-friendly pressed cardboard, Domilovo’s packaging is sturdy and sustainable. The unique henroost-inspired design fits seven eggs tightly, protecting them while giving off a wholesome farm feel. [source ]


Friss Box
Minimalist and efficient, the Friss Box uses just a single piece of microwaved cardboard. Eggs sit in oval-shaped cutouts, and you can grab them easily by turning the top. Simple, sleek, and eco-friendly. [source ]


Tojástartó
This space-saving, glue-free design uses two pieces of corrugated cardboard. It’s strong, waste-reducing, and even has a clever snap feature that lets eggs pop out from the bottom when pressed. [source ]
